    In 1887, the hospital began offering a training program for nurses at the hospital. In 1903, the School of Nursing was officially established as a three-year diploma program under Eleanor Kelly as a department of Saint Luke's Hospital of Kansas City (the successor to All Saints Hospital). Three students enrolled in the first year of operation ...

    Gaylor is an unincorporated community in Wayne County, in the U.S. state of Missouri. [1] The community was on the Black River south of Clearwater Lake approximately one mile north of Leeper. [2] A variant name was "Chilton". [3]

    Gaylord was founded in 1870. [4] It was named for C. E. Gaylord, a native of Marshall County, who was one of the town's founders. [4] [5] The Gaylord post office opened in June 1871. [6] Gaylord was a station on the Missouri Pacific Railroad. [7]
